Analysis

The most recent figure for chickens, broilers — manure applied to soils that volatilises in China is 76.68 million kg, measured in 2023.

That represents a change of down 3.2% on the previous year and down 8.9% over ten years.

Over the whole period, chickens, broilers — manure applied to soils that volatilises in China peaked at 107.36 million kg in 2010 and was at its lowest, 5.85 million kg, in 1961.

China ranks 3rd of 209 countries on this measure, in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.

Averages by decade

DecadeAverage LowestHighest Years
1960s 6.60 million kg 5.85 million kg 7.14 million kg 9
1970s 8.97 million kg 6.84 million kg 12.05 million kg 10
1980s 28.19 million kg 14.45 million kg 49.40 million kg 10
1990s 66.76 million kg 51.30 million kg 92.18 million kg 10
2000s 84.28 million kg 66.32 million kg 105.25 million kg 10
2010s 84.97 million kg 74.26 million kg 107.36 million kg 10
2020s 78.61 million kg 76.68 million kg 79.98 million kg 4

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
